Ohio Lawmaker Needs Regulation Requiring Police to Report Race Throughout Site visitors Stops

An Ohio lawmaker says she’s going to introduce laws requiring police businesses to file race knowledge when making visitors stops, following a Marshall Mission – Cleveland investigation into how the village of Bratenahl tickets principally Black drivers from neighboring Cleveland.

State Rep. Juanita Brent, a Democrat from Cleveland, mentioned the data is required to find out whether or not police businesses unfairly cease extra Black and Brown drivers in comparison with White drivers.

The Marshall Mission – Cleveland’s investigation famous that 60% or extra of drivers cited for visitors violations by Bratenahl police since 2020 have been Black.

Brent mentioned she intends to introduce the proposed laws in January 2023 when the Ohio Common Meeting begins its subsequent legislative session.

“The one method we are able to make systemic change (in policing) is with the info,” Brent advised The Marshall Mission – Cleveland. “The information has to assist what persons are saying in public.”

The choice in Ohio to gather race info is made on the native degree.

In 2020, New York College’s Faculty of Regulation’s Policing Mission known as state legal guidelines that require officers to file race knowledge “a gold commonplace.” As of 2020, the group mentioned solely 20 states required the gathering.

Bratenahl officers didn’t file race info in almost half of all circumstances between Jan. 1, 2020, and Sept. 15, 2022. After nationwide protests following George Floyd’s homicide by a White Minneapolis police officer in Could 2020, The Ohio Collaborative — a panel of legislation enforcement specialists and neighborhood leaders — established voluntary state requirements for use-of-force, body-worn cameras and monitoring race knowledge. Bratenahl police sought accreditation from the Ohio Collaborative within the fall of 2020 and began recording race knowledge of drivers throughout visitors stops quickly after.

Kayla S. Griffin, president of the NAACP’s Cleveland department, mentioned Bratenahl’s ticket practices present the necessity for gathering race knowledge, including: “It’s an outstanding thought. Different states have attacked these points.”

Not everybody helps legislation enforcement gathering race knowledge.

Robert Cornwell, govt director of the Buckeye State Sheriffs’ Affiliation, mentioned sheriffs oppose the concept as a result of visitors stops are sometimes adversarial and officers asking for race info may amplify conditions.

Lawmakers can resolve the difficulty by passing laws that may require the Ohio Bureau of Motor Autos to make drivers disclose their race when issuing or renewing a driver’s license, he mentioned.

The affiliation, Cornwell mentioned, has requested the Bureau of Motor Autos to contemplate the requirement, however the thought has been met with a “lukewarm reception” the previous two years.

Jocelyn Rosnick, coverage director on the ACLU of Ohio, mentioned that whereas knowledge assortment shouldn’t be a panacea for ending systemic racism in policing, it’s most actually a software to assist perceive the extent to which Black and Brown communities are focused and disproportionately impacted by means of extreme policing.

“The burden shouldn’t be on impacted communities, advocates and the media to spend numerous hours combing by means of piecemealed information,” Rosnick mentioned. “Cohesive, statewide knowledge assortment on visitors stops can be a step in the appropriate path — although we all know far more can be wanted, together with rigorous monitoring of this knowledge and significant reforms.”

Roughly 3 in 4 of Bratenahl’s 1,400 residents are White. Bratenahl is dwelling to folks corresponding to Cleveland Browns soccer group homeowners Jimmy and Dee Haslam and Cleveland Cavaliers basketball star Kevin Love. It’s surrounded by Cleveland and shares a ZIP code with Glenville, one in every of Cleveland’s poorest neighborhoods.

Almost all visitors tickets issued by Bratenahl officers between Jan. 1 and Sept. 15, 2022, went to drivers outdoors the village, The Marshall Mission – Cleveland discovered. About one-third went to 3 majority-Black Cleveland neighborhoods: Glenville, North Shore Collinwood and Collinwood-Nottingham.

Over 60% of drivers ticketed in 2022 got here from areas with larger poverty charges, decrease family revenue, and bigger non-White populations than most Ohio communities.

Cleveland Metropolis Councilman Kevin Conwell, who represents town’s Glenville neighborhood, mentioned he plans to quickly meet with Bratenahl Police Chief Charles LoBello to debate complaints about visitors stops.

LoBello mentioned he requested a gathering with Conwell “to get to know one another.”

Conwell additionally mentioned he’ll meet with Cleveland Municipal Courtroom Administrative Decide Michelle Earley to search out methods to teach Cleveland drivers on how you can request that Bratenahl visitors circumstances be moved to Cleveland courts.

Ronnie Dunn, govt director of the Variety Institute at Cleveland State College, mentioned it’s tough to get statewide assist for such assortment efforts. He cited the makes an attempt of former state consultant Peter Lawson Jones within the late Nineties to get assist for a statewide legislation to stop racial profiling.

The visitors knowledge needs to be collected and made public to make sure transparency throughout police stops. Dunn, additionally an affiliate professor of city research and public affairs on the college, mentioned Ohio is behind many different states relating to laws requiring the gathering of race knowledge by legislation enforcement.

“I actually discover it unconscionable that right this moment, on this period of massive knowledge, we wouldn’t gather knowledge on all varieties of police interactions with the general public … visitors stops included,” Dunn mentioned.
